Canon EMEA is looking for a talented Data Engineer to take ownership of the design, development, and maintenance of robust data pipelines and cloud-based infrastructure across Google Cloud Platform (GCP) and Microsoft Azure. In this role, you will play a key part in ensuring seamless data integration and accessibility, enabling Canon's ITCG Marketing, eCommerce, and CRM teams to make data-driven decisions and deliver impactful customer and commercial initiatives. This is an opportunity to join a globally recognised brand where your expertise will directly support marketing effectiveness, customer engagement, and business performance across the EMEA region.
Responsibilities
- Design, build, and maintain collections of sophisticated data pipelines, models and visualisations that integrate marketing and sales data with other internal and external data sources in Google BigQuery and Power BI to support Canon’s ITCG marketing, ecommerce and CRM team initiatives.
- Perform exploratory analysis using Python/R and SQL to uncover trends, anomalies, and business opportunities in ITCG digital marketing and sales data and present back insights and recommendations to key stakeholders.
- Create, present and maintain dashboards and ad-hoc reports in Power BI based on requirements gathered from key stakeholders to deliver actionable insights and support data-driven decisions.
- Identify and automate repetitive data tasks, workflows, and processes to improve efficiency and reduce manual data handling utilising Google Cloud and Microsoft Azure platforms.
- Develop and optimise data models that support scalable and efficient data storage, processing, and retrieval within Google Cloud and Microsoft Azure platforms.
- Implement data validation and cleansing processes to ensure data accuracy and reliability before it's used in downstream systems and collaborate with IT on upstream changes required.
Qualifications
- Excellent SQL skills
- Understanding of data warehousing, data modelling concepts and structuring new data tables
- Knowledge of cloud-based data warehousing (Google BigQuery)
- Experience developing in a BI tool (Power BI or similar)
- Python or R proficiency, particularly in areas of automation and integrations
